Abstract:
      Two kinds of discrete models are presented for modeling a particle-fluid system at different levels (different time-spatial scales and accuracy) in the framework of lattice Boltzmann method,namely lattice Boltzmann based particle-resolved direct numerical simulation (LB-based PR-DNS) and lattice Boltzmann based discrete particle simulation (LB-based DPS).The exploratory study on lattice Boltzmann based two-fluid model (LB-based TFM) in Euler-Euler framework is also reviewed.LB-based PR-DNS where particle size is much larger than lattice size,can directly resolve the flow at gas-solid interface and detailed dynamic interaction,while LB-based DPS where lattice size is much larger than particle diameter,achieves a good balance between computational accuracy,time consumption and computational efficiency,and can obtain the macro information such as time-averaged flow field,as well as the local information such as particle trajectories.Both LB-based DNS and DPS are powerful tools in exploring particle-fluid system,but further reasearch into LB-based TFM is still needed to be developed in the future.
